About Forest View Elementary School

Forest View Elementary School is a public elementary school in Everett, WA, part of Everett School District, serving approximately 641 students in grades Pre-K-5th with a 18.3: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 9.0 out of 10 and ranks #115 of 2,228 schools in WA. State assessment records show 80%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024) and 85%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024).
